login  Naam:   Wachtwoord: 
Registreer je!
 Forum

ALLES printen (Opgelost)

Offline vinTage - 05/03/2009 01:04 (laatste wijziging 05/03/2009 01:07)
Avatar van vinTageNieuw lid Hey lezer,

Onlangs heb ik een site gescript, die maandelijks een resum facturen produceert (zichtbaar voor admin).
Nu wil die klant AL de facturen in één klik af kunnen printen, maar de facturen worden gegenereerd "per factuur"...

Bestaat er een mogelijkheid om aan zijn vraag te voldoen (maakt niet uit in welke taal (hoop ik) )...

eventueel is het zelfs een optie om een bepaald programma daarvoor te downloaden(wat ik dus moet maken), maar VOORDAT ik mezelf stort op een bepaalde taal wil ik eerst ZEKER weten dat dit mogelijk is...

Dus concreet wil ik weten of een programma/webapp kan
-connecten (evt inoggen)
-een select doen naar een bepaald php script
WHILE
{
-uitprinten wat dat script genereert (PER FACTUUR een print)
}


thx 

5 antwoorden

Gesponsorde links
Offline Ontani - 05/03/2009 08:15
Avatar van Ontani Gouden medailleGouden medailleGouden medailleGouden medaille

-1
Ik zou eerder alle gegevens opnieuw ophalen en 1 print genereren.
Offline jaronneke - 05/03/2009 08:44
Avatar van jaronneke MySQL interesse alles in een while lus zetten en uitprinten met 'fpdf'
Offline Martijn - 05/03/2009 11:50
Avatar van Martijn Crew PHP als je het met een while doet, kan de buffer van je printer vollopen als het een beetje oude printer is beter is denk een manier vinden daardoor je een nieuwe pagina kan maken , en dan met een while alles tot 1 opdracht genereren, met steeds een nieuwe pagina per factuur
Offline Godlord - 05/03/2009 16:26
Avatar van Godlord PHP gevorderde
Citaat:
als je het met een while doet, kan de buffer van je printer vollopen als het een beetje oude printer is

Vaak regelt de printer driver dit en dus niet de printer zelf. Eerder zou dus waarschijnlijk, bij een blocking printer driver het geheugen "vollopen" of in sommige gevallen "overlopen" dan het geheugen van de printer. In de meeste gevallen zal de driver wel een wait request sturen anyway waarmee dit vermeden kan worden. Zou deze implementatie niet bestaan in het besturingssysteem dan hebben die mensen ongelofelijke issues. In ieder geval dit als je reëel print.

Als het een reactie is op wat jaronneke zei dan wordt met printen bedoelt generen (referendum).

Voor het topic zelf hoef ik niet aan te vullen of een andere inbreng te posten aangezien drie mensen dit al voor me gedaan hebben.
Offline vinTage - 05/03/2009 17:17
Avatar van vinTage Nieuw lid Ik ga doen wat Ontani zei, ism met een pagebreak moet dit goed te doen zijn.
  1. .pagebreak
  2. {
  3. page-break-before: always
  4. }
Gesponsorde links
Dit onderwerp is gesloten.
Actieve forumberichten
© 2002-2024 Sitemasters.be - Regels - Laadtijd: 0.25s